Dark, I agree with your assessment about interactive fiction. Unfortunately, there's little replay value in most of it, though to be fair I am not quite sure what could be done to add any, short of some randomness, which always creates problems when a programmer of IF tries it I've found. An alternative to interactive fiction are the roguelike games I play a lot. There is even a Zcode version of Rogue, the original and simplest game of this genre. These games sacrifice plot and such for totally randomized areas, challenges, etc. If you can play them at all, they're worth the trouble. I am actually surprised not more blind people get into these, but then again I guess that accessing them isn't so easy as it used to be. Strategy games, like SoundRTS, especially with multiple players, have replay value as well. I've been waiting forever for an audio version of Civilization or the like. I wish wholeheartedly that a developer might try this concept someday. Anyway, I hope this might be some food for thought.
